Acute Phase: Total Loss
The acute phase hits immediately after triggers like viral infections, marking complete or near-complete sense of smell loss known as anosmia, often paired with ageusia or taste distortion. Patients report metallic or burnt smells even in neutral air, affecting 60-80% of COVID-19 cases per 2021 Loma Linda University data. This stage, lasting 1-7 days, stems from olfactory support cell damage rather than direct nerve death, explaining rapid initial shifts.
- Complete blackouts-no scents detected, even strong ones like coffee or garlic.
- Distorted perceptions-parosmia emerges with cigarette-like or sewage odors from safe foods.
- Safety risks rise: undetected gas leaks or spoiled milk pose immediate threats.
- Emotional toll peaks-72% report anxiety, mirroring 2022 Nature journal surveys.
Early Recovery: Fluctuations Begin
By weeks 2-4, the early recovery stage brings intermittent smell detection, strongest in mornings and fading later, with common metallic or chemical tastes. NHS guidelines note 50% notice partial return here, driven by regenerating support cells nourishing olfactory nerves. Tracking via daily journals reveals patterns, reducing frustration amid ups and downs.
- Monitor twice daily: Sniff known odors like lemon or rose upon waking and evening.
- Log intensity: Rate 0-10 to chart progress quantitatively.
- Initiate smell training: 20 seconds per scent, twice daily, using four varied oils.
- Avoid irritants: Skip smoking, which delays recovery by 30% per RefHelp stats.

Olfactory Training Protocol
Smell training remains the gold standard, involving 15-25 second sniffs of four scents twice daily for 3 months, then rotating sets. Fifth Sense charity, founded 2012, endorses memory-linked odors like childhood perfumes for 25% better outcomes. Evidence from Ion.ac.uk trials shows nerve cell turnover stimulation, cutting recovery time by weeks.
- Select scents: Classic set-rose, eucalyptus, lemon, clove-via essential oils.
- Sniff cycle: 20s inhale, 10s rest, visualize memories intensely.
- Repeat set: Twice daily, morning/night, for 90 days minimum.
- Rotate: Switch to thyme, jasmine post-3 months if partial gains.
- Track: Use apps logging intensity, sharing data with ENT specialists.
Safety Tips During Recovery
Impaired smell heightens hazards, so install smoke detectors with fresh batteries and label expiration dates boldly. Sleep & Sinus Centers' 2026 report urges gas alarms for 25% undetected leak risk. Support groups via Fifth Sense cut isolation, with 80% reporting better coping.
- Stove checks: Double-verify off positions post-cooking.
- Food safety: Texture, sight, taste proxies until smell returns.
- Professional aid: ENT referral if no change by week 6.
- Mental health: Journaling halves anxiety per Henry Ford studies.

How long does smell loss last?
Most recover fully within 3-6 months, with 90% by 6 weeks for acute viral cases and two-thirds by 18 months for persistent ones, per NHS Lothian 2026 guidelines.
Why does parosmia happen in recovery?
Parosmia arises as miswired nerves fire distorted signals during regeneration, common in 30% during weeks 4-12, resolving as pathways mature.
Does COVID smell loss differ from other causes?
Yes-COVID targets support cells for faster initial recovery (4-6 weeks average), versus trauma-induced nerve damage taking 12+ months, per LLU 2021 data.
Can diet or vitamins speed recovery?
Omega-3s and vitamin A show promise in pilots, aiding cell regeneration, but steroids reduce inflammation faster; consult doctors, as garlic remedies risk irritation.
When to see a doctor urgently?
Seek care if no hints by week 6, paired symptoms like headaches, or unilateral loss signaling tumors (rare, <5%).
Is permanent loss possible?
Yes, 5-10% face lifelong anosmia from nerve death, but training mitigates to functional levels.
